Each Fall, LA Film Prize takes over downtown Shreveport for five days. In that time, we see 20 of the best short films from across the country on the big screen. In addition, various bands compete in Louisiana Music Prize and we see some of the best chefs duke it out in Louisiana Food Prize.

This year's festival, Prize Fest, will take place Thursday, October 4 through Sunday, October 8.

What started as a small get together of 400 or so people, has blossomed to a must-see experience that attracts close to 5,000 people each year. 2017 marks year number six for the prize and in those short years they have brought in millions of dollars of economic impact to Northwest Louisiana. Filmmakers from all across the country flock to this festival each year with more than 150 short films being submitted for consideration.

Rule number one is that you have to shoot your film in Northwest Louisiana.

The winning film takes home $50,000 and is determined by 50 percent public vote and 50 percent panel of judges. Believe me when I say, you need to check this baby out! And this year's all-inclusive Prize Fest combo pass will get you in to see everything, Film Prize, Music Prize and Food Prize.
